Female nude, c. 1920s
RPPC Real picture postcard Important German nude female study by Lotte Herrlich, circa 1920 - full length standing study of a slim and possibly oiled female nude from a three quarter rear angle, evidently using a soft focus mask at the edges of the shot for artistic impact. Herrlich was a major figure in both German photography and the naturism movement in the first decades of the 20th Century, famous equally for her nudes and her landscapes. Text on the reverse, printed on the plain back, shows the photo to have been published by the journal, "Die Schonheit", which was a major proponent of Herrlich's work. Numbered as series 126. Unused. Has a glue adhesion line on top edge of reverse, otherwise virtually unmarked. |
